- The distance between Bomnak, Russia and Verhojansk, Russia is approximately 1,449 km or 900 mi.
- To reach Bomnak in this distance one would set out from Verhojansk bearing 191.7° or SS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Bomnak bearing 187.7° or S .
- Bomnak has a boreal subarctic climate with dry winters (Dwc) whereas Verhojansk has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season and extremely severe winters (Dfd).
- Bomnak is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Verhojansk is in or near the subpolar dry tundra biome.
- The mean temperature is 10.5 °C (18.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.3 °C (23.9°F) less in Bomnak. The continentality subtype is hypercont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 407.2 mm (16 in) more which is equivalent to 407.2 l/m² (9.99 US gal/ft²) or 4,072,000 l/ha (435,324 US gal/ac) more. About 3 1/3 as much.
- There are 38 more hours of sunlight per year in Bomnak. In whichever way circa 0h 06' more per day or about 1 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 12.7° higher in Bomnak than in Verhojansk.
- Relative humidity levels are 1.7%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 10°C (18°F) higher.
